Pros

Depending on the manager, you can have opportunities for training, promotion, and grooming for management. The benefits are comprehensive, and there are contributory retirement plans.

Cons

The wrong manager can set the tone for the whole department, and many of them are promoting a back-biting, fault-finding, unfair system that rewards dishonest, unethical, and obsequious individuals over hardworking truth-tellers.
